Premium Only Content
This video is only available to Rumble Premium subscribers. Subscribe to
enjoy exclusive content and ad-free viewing.

Watch: BRICS Foreign Ministers meet in Cape Town
2 years ago
5
South Africa - Cape Town - 1 June 2023 - Heavy police presence outside the Luxurious Twelve Apostles Hotel and Spa in Cape Town which plays host for the meeting of the BRICS Ministers of Foreign Affairs and International Relations. Photographer: Armand Hough / African News Agency (ANA)
Loading comments...
-
LIVE
Edge of Wonder
5 hours agoIs Cloud Seeding ‘Rainmaker’ Connected to Texas Floods?
308 watching -
LIVE
LIVE WITH CHRIS'WORLD
24 minutes agoLIVE WITH CHRIS'WORLD - DO YOU FEEL LIED TO?
88 watching -
1:06:31
BonginoReport
3 hours agoIs Trump Trying To Sweep Epstein Under The Rug? - Nightly Scroll w/ Hayley Caronia (Ep.85)
107K104 -
1:19:40
Kim Iversen
4 hours agoDid Cloud Seeding Cause The Texas Floods?
90.1K59 -
57:28
Redacted News
4 hours agoHe's EXPOSING the Secret Dark History of The W.H.O and the Pandemic Treaty | Redacted Conversation
64.1K38 -
5:35:46
StoneMountain64
6 hours agoREMATCH is PEAK gaming in 2025
59.6K2 -
LIVE
LFA TV
22 hours agoLFA TV ALL DAY STREAM - TUESDAY 7/8/25
737 watching -
30:00
Uncommon Sense In Current Times
2 hours ago $0.14 earnedTeaching Kids to Pray for Persecuted Christians | Children's Prayer Passport | Ryan Brown
3.44K -
16:19
Professor Gerdes Explains 🇺🇦
4 hours ago🚨 Trump Defied Putin...Or Was It All a LIE? (Proof!)
3.75K6 -
54:24
The Dr. Ardis Show
5 hours ago $4.86 earnedThe Dr. Ardis Show | The Great Tooth Deception w Heather Paul | Episode 06.20.2025
17.7K4